VIETNAM or INDOCHINA WAR (s)
2
DAI VIET
  • Vietnamese kingdom originates in Red River valley
    in north.
  • Becomes independent in 9th century.
  • Fights for independence from China.
  • Eventually expands into south part of todays
    Vietnam.

3
FRENCH INDOCHINA
  • French colonize parts of Southeast Asia in 1880s,
    incl. Kingdom of Vietnam
  • When French fall to Nazis and Japanese in World
    War II, Vietnamese led by Communist Ho Chi Minh
    begin revolt

4
HO CHI MINH
  • Defeats French in 1954 at Battle of Dienbienphu
  • French, Communists sign Geneva Accords

5
GENEVA ACCORDS
  • Laos and Cambodia to become independent.
  • Vietnam split into North under Communist
    control, and South non-Communist
  • Elections to be held in two years (1956) to
    decide government for whole country

6
THE OUTCOME
  • Elections are never held.
  • US and South Vietnam
  • Fear Communist trickery
  • Ngo Dinh Diem is made
  • President of South Viet-
  • Nam with American
  • backing

7
DOMINO THEORY and COMMITMENTS
  • US pledged through SEATO treaty to defend
    Thailand, Philippines and South Vietnam.
  • Domino Theory fear that if one country in SE
    Asia becomes Communist, they all will follow. SE
    Asia is considered strategic area.

8
DIEM
  • Unpopular as president. Strict Catholic in a
    Buddhist country
  • Authoritarian, aloof from the people
  • Communists lead a movement against Diem
    National Liberation Front Communists become
    known as Vietcong
  • 1963 - Buddhist protests and betrayal by
    military officers lead to his downfall

9
DILEMNA!
  • What was US to do about South Vietnam?
  • Vietcong, backed by North Vietnam and USSR, were
    making gains in countryside.
  • But there was no viable government.

10
US INVOLVEMENT
  • US backs a series of military governments, begins
    massive bombing of North Vietnam and begins
    sending massive numbers of combat troops in 1965.

11
LAOS and CAMBODIA
  • Communist-led uprisings also take place in these
    two monarchies
  • Vietcong make great use of the mountainous border
    with these countries for their supply line from
    North Vietnam, called the Ho Chi Minh Trail

12
TET OFFENSIVE
  • Surprise attack by VC and North Vietnamese across
    South Vietnam during traditional truce period.
  • Gives lie to US predictions of
  • speedy
  • victory.

13
MY LAI MASSACRE
  • American troops are ordered to destroy a South
    Vietnamese village and end up massacring 450
    inhabitants
  • Public reaction against war inflamed, but many
    find it excusable.

14
VIETNAMIZAION
  • Elected president in 1968, Nixon promises to turn
    more of fighting over to the South Vietnamese.
  • However, to support them he continues the bombing
    campaign on VC supply lines on North Vietnam and,
    in 1970, orders bombing and invasion of Cambodia.

15
KILLLING FIELDS
  • US invasion of Cambodia de-stabilizes neutral
    government
  • In 1975, very extreme Communist group Khmer
    Rouge take over
  • Empty cities, kill anyone not a peasant
  • One million die one of every eight Cambodians.
    Many flee to Thailand, US.

16
(No Transcript)
17
PEACE TALKS
  • Begin in 1970
  • Two years spent arguing over the shape of the
    table
  • Cease-fire signed in January, 1973.
  • American troops go home. Most prisoners of war
    are released.

18
END OF WAR
  • 1975-Communists break cease-fire terms and
    quickly overwhelm South Vietnamese.
  • North and South Vietnam are re-unified. Saigon
    becomes Ho Chi Minh City.
  • Communists also win in Laos and
    Cambodia-Bloodbath in Cambodia.

19
